Reflections on results
Per capita figure high at 18.77t CO2e vs Highland 9.5t (DECC 2013)
Presence of large industries- Smelting 3.39t- Quarrying 2.61t
Inclusion of areas not normally accounted- Fishing 1.2t
Geographical factors- Use of energy at home per HH
- Lochaber 7.39t Scottish average 6.2t (CCF)- Road transport
- Lochaber 3.8t Scottish average 2t (DECC)

Comments on data compilation
• High quality data
– Electricity from DECC– Non electricity fuel data contributed from public bodies
and local industries– Transport fuel data contributed for fishing, passenger
railways, steam train– MSW from Highland Council– Industrial emissions reported to SEPA through SPRI– Livestock based on June census

Data cont.
• Medium quality data– Use of fuels other than electricity– Road transport based on DfT AADF– Rail freight based on research (Clarke and Van Kalles)– Waste water emissions based on population
• Low quality data– Off grid gas data not available

Comments on value of GPC
• Clear and consistent with UK national inventory
• Use of energy needs to be disaggregated
• Transport emissions complex
• Tourism has a very significant effect – on transport but also on waste and energy

Last but not least
• Consumption emissions not accounted
- both higher than territorial and rising rather than falling (Barrett et al, 2013)
• ICLEI – USA and PAS 2070 propose ways to deal with this through a hybrid account
• GLA has carried out a trial assessment of PAS 2070 for London (BSI, 2014)
![Page 10: Global Protocol for Community Scale GHG Accounting | Susan Carstairs](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022062419/558ba3ffd8b42ac34a8b462a/html5/thumbnails/10.jpg)
1010
London
• Three reports for 2010• London Energy and Greenhouse Gas Inventory
– 5.51t CO2e per cap
• Direct Plus Supply Chain– 10.05t CO2e per cap
• Consumption Based Methodology– 14.15t CO2e per cap
